Meehan Range Redgate Section
28 June 2017
Went on a walk up the climb to traverse the ridge near Simmons Hill before arcing along the opposite ridge leading back east.
It was hoped that a track would take us down to near the start in String Bark Gully, but the one found was on private property for most of the way until a house could be spotted a short distance ahead. At this point we veered away and just walked through untracked bush to the bottom.
